Hydraulic engineering ecological slope protection method
By introducing adjustment mechanisms such as delivery pipes, L-shaped rods, Y-shaped pipes, and shielding nets into ecological slope protection in water conservancy projects, the problems of easy plant withering and the need for manual irrigation have been solved, realizing automated irrigation and shielding, and improving the applicability and efficiency of ecological slope protection.

AI Technical Summary
Existing ecological slope protection devices for water conservancy projects are inadequate in terms of plant protection and irrigation. Plants are easily affected by external forces and wither, and irrigation operations require manual labor, limiting their applicability.
An adjustable mechanism is used, including components such as delivery pipes, L-shaped rods, Y-shaped pipes, pumps, and shade nets, which are connected by bolts to form a movable irrigation system. Water is drawn in by a suction head and sprayed out through a nozzle to automatically irrigate the plants, and the shade nets are fixed by inserting rods.
It has achieved automated plant irrigation and shading, which has improved the applicability and efficiency of ecological slope protection, reduced manual operation, and enhanced the stability and ecological restoration effect of the slope.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of water conservancy engineering technology, specifically to an ecological slope protection method for water conservancy projects. Background Technology
[0002] During the construction of water conservancy projects, in order to ensure the safety of riverbank slopes and their environment, vegetation is planted to protect and reinforce the surface of the slope by utilizing the interaction between plants and rocks and soil (such as the anchoring effect of root systems). This ensures that the slope surface can meet the requirements for stability while restoring the damaged natural ecological environment.
[0003] However, existing ecological slope protection devices for water conservancy projects have some problems in use. The existing slope protection devices are not convenient for protecting the plants on the slope. The plants may wither and die due to external forces. At the same time, watering the plants on the slope often requires manual operation, which is not convenient for irrigating slopes of different heights, thus reducing the applicability of the device. [0031] Multiple delivery pipes 19 are connected together, and the delivery pipes 19 are connected to L-shaped rods 7 and Y-shaped pipes 16. The shielding net 6 is placed on the slope 1, and the insertion rod 23 is inserted into the soil of the slope 1 to limit the shielding net 6. The delivery pipes 19, L-shaped rods 7 and Y-shaped pipes 16 are connected by bolts 9. The suction head 4 is placed in the water, and the pump 2 absorbs the water through the suction head 4. The water enters the delivery pipes 19 and is sprayed out through the nozzles 21 to irrigate the plants. The device itself has mobility, which improves the applicability of the device.
[0032] Working principle: When the device starts working, it is first divided into multiple parts. The L-shaped rod 7 is placed on the top of the slope 1, and the first roller 11 on the L-shaped rod 7 is attached to the top of the slope 1. The first limiting plate 13 is placed in the adjacent groove. Then, multiple conveying pipes 19 are connected. The uppermost conveying pipe 19 is connected to the L-shaped rod 7, and the lowermost conveying pipe 19 is connected to the Y-shaped pipe 16. The conveying pipes 19, L-shaped rod 7, and Y-shaped pipe 16 are connected by the first flange 8, the second flange 17, and the third flange 20 with bolts 9. The second roller 18 at the bottom of the Y-shaped pipe 16 contacts the ground, and the second limiting plate 14 is located in the adjacent groove, thus completing the installation of the device. The shade net 6 is then adjusted. The shade net 6 is connected to the delivery pipe 19 via the elastic plate 24. The shade net 6 is located above the plants on the slope 1. When it is necessary to limit the shade net 6, the position of the insertion rod 23 is adjusted and inserted into the soil to limit the shade net 6. When it is necessary to irrigate the plants, the suction head 4 is placed in the water and the pump 2 is started. The pump 2 absorbs water through the hose 3 and the suction head 4. The water enters the Y-shaped pipe 16 and then enters the delivery pipe 19. The nozzle 21 discharges the water. At the same time, the device can also move left and right to remove the insertion rod 23 from the soil. The device can move left and right via the first roller 11 and the second roller 18.
